## Invoice renderer tweaks

This PR swaps the Pinwheel PDF renderer over to streamed page output so big invoices from Tarnfeld accounts stop blowing the memory cap. Nothing fancy — same layout engine, just chunked writes and a sane font cache. New folks: the knobs that matter are listed here.

tuning table, yajog-yahof:
BUDGETS = {
    "lamvan": 303,
    "wenox": 460,
    "fenvan": 525,
}

Changed defaults in Splitfork, our assignment service. Bucketing now uses sticky hashing per account instead of per session, and the holdout slice grew from 2% to 5%. Callers relying on session-level reassignment must opt in explicitly. Review the diff against the new baseline; the updated default configuration is listed below.

config for tagep-kajof:
[casir]
port = 6379
region = south-1
host = casir.paliqdyn.example
team = tamax
timeout_ms = 250
retries = 2

### Step 4 — Verify the assignment service build

Before you tell customers the new Splitlane experiment-assignment rollout is live, make sure the deployed bundle actually passed verification. Support doesn't deploy anything, but you can check the status page for a green signature badge. If it's red, escalate — don't wave it through. Verification uses the release key below:

rollout seal: bky4_DFM9

Transport of reservoir water samples

Water samples collected from the Bremmock Reservoir are packed in insulated carriers with ice packs and a chain-of-custody sheet taped to the lid. Shift leads must check the seal numbers against the sheet before release and keep carriers refrigerated until collection. The courier hand-over follows this instruction:

handover note for bajog-tawig: the lamion quenael courier leaves the wendor ledger at gate 1289 under passcode 760784